KXEO Sports Report For 3/23/19

The Mexico Bulldogs Baseball Team with a win over the Moberly Spartans 11-10 last (Friday) night in their home opener.

The Bulldogs trailed 10-7 into the bottom of the seventh inning, a walk off error sealed the victory for the Bulldogs.

Zach Watkins pitched 4 innings striking out 4 and giving up 5 runs.

Ty Prince and Taylor Bledsoe with 2 runs.

Mexico picked up their first NCMC win of the season and improved to 2-4 overall.

They play again today (Saturday) against California with a 1 pm start time.

Mizzou Women’s Basketball team still dancing after defeating Drake in overtime 77-76 yesterday (Friday).

The score was tied at 76 with 15 seconds on the clock, when junior guard Jordan Roundtree took a last effort shot and was fouled behind the three point line.

Roundtree drained one of three free throws, putting the Tigers up by one point with over a second left in the game.

A quick shot by Drake missed the mark and the Tigers won the game.

Mizzou will play in the second round of the tournament tomorrow (Saturday) in Iowa City.

The St. Louis Billikens are eliminated from the NCAA Tournament after losing to Virginia Tech 66-52 last (Friday) night.

The Missouri Tigers Wrestling Team is fifth in the NCAA wrestling championships after four sessions and four All Americans from the program are crowned.

John Erneste earned his first All-America honor with a blood round, triple overtime win.

True freshman Brock Mauller also earned All-America honors with an overtime pin.

Jaydin Eierman and Daniel Lewis round out the Mizzou grapplers with the All-America honors.
